The Role

Your central point of

coordination

Most planning failures don't happen because of a single bad decision.

They happen because decisions are made in silos — your attorney

working separately from your CPA, your financial advisor unaware of

estate changes, your business succession plan disconnected from

personal goals.

John sits at the center of your professional team, ensuring every

advisor is working from the same set of priorities and toward aligned outcomes.

John C. Gross III, LUTCF | LACP

Founder & Lead Advisor

John works with business owners, families, and high-net-worth individuals navigating complex planning decisions. His role is not to replace existing advisors, but to serve as the central strategist who ensures all professionals are aligned.

With decades of experience in estate planning coordination, business transition strategy, and tax reduction planning, John brings a structured approach to situations that often feel overwhelming or fragmented.

His process begins with understanding — listening to what matters most before recommending any course of action. This conversation-first approach helps clients see the full picture before committing to decisions that are difficult to reverse.

Credentials & Designations

  • LUTCF — Life Underwriter Training Council Fellow

  • LACP — Life and Annuity Certified Professional

  • Member, Estate Planning Council of St. Louis

  • Member, Society of Financial Service Professionals (FSP)

  • Member, NAIFA Missouri
